More Information For technical support and other information, please contact your sales representative or contact us by email. www.kaonmedia.com I sales_support@kaonmedia.com 3 Product Overview Each AR3030W has five (5) LEDs, two (2) RJ-45 Gigabit Ethernet LAN ports, WPS and RESET buttons and a Power Connector. See the explanation below:
LED: 2.4G, 5G, ETH, MESH, POWER Power Connector: For Connecting AR3030W to the a power outlet via the provided power adaptor Reset Button: For resetting AR3030W to factory default settings WPS Button: For creating a mesh network between AR3030W devices Ethernet Ports: For connecting AR3030W to your home gateway, the Ethernet outlet or other internet devices. 4 LEDs Each AR3030W has five (5) LEDs that changes color according to its status. See the explanation below:
LED description LED 2.4G 5G ETH Color Green Yellow Green Yellow Green None Blue Description The 2.4GHz radio is operating. Case 1 : The Wi-Fi connection between AR3030Ws is weak. Case 2 : The additional AR3030W is not connected to the AR3030W connected to your home gateway. The 2.4GHz radio is operating. Case 1 : The Wi-Fi connection between AR3030Ws is weak. Case 2 : The additional AR3030W is not connected to the AR3030W connected to your home gateway. The Ethernet device is connected to an Ethernet port The Ethernet device is not connected to AR3030W. The primary AR3030W connected to your home gateway completes to create a mesh network. 2.4G Green Yellow 5G Green Yellow ETH Green None MESH POWER Green Blue Green None MESH Blinking Blue The primary AR3030W connected to your home gateway is creating a mesh network. Green The additional AR3030W(s) completes to create a mesh network. Blinking Green The additional AR3030W(s) is creating a mesh network. Power Green AR3030W is ready. This device complies with Part 15 of the FCC Rules. Operation is subject to the following two conditions:
(1) this device may not cause harmful interference, and
(2) this device must accept any interference received, including interference that may cause undesired operation. FCC Part 15.105 statement This equipment has been tested and found to comply with the limits for a Class B digital device, pursuant to part 15 of the FCC Rules. These limits are designed to provide reasonable protection against harmful interference in a residential installation. This equipment generates, uses and can radiate radio frequency energy and, if not installed and used in accordance with the instructions, may cause harmful interference to radio communications. However, there is no guarantee that interference will not occur in a particular installation. If this equipment does cause harmful interference to radio or television reception, which can be determined by turning the equipment off and on, the user is encouraged to try to correct the interference by one or more of the following measures:
- Reorient or relocate the receiving antenna.
- Increase the separation between the equipment and receiver.
- Connect the equipment into an outlet on a circuit different from that to which the receiver is connected.
- Consult the dealer or an experienced radio/TV technician for help. FCC Part 15.21 statement Any changes or modifications not expressly approved by the party responsible for compliance could void the user's authority to operate this equipment. RF Exposure Statement (MPE) The antenna(s) must be installed such that a minimum separation distance of at least 20 cm is maintained between the radiator (antenna) and all persons at all times. This device must not be co-located or operating in conjunction with any other antenna or transmitter. 17

Facility and Accreditations 2.1 Test Facility The measurement facility is located at (Ho-dong), 113, Yejik-ro, Cheoin-gu, Yongin-si, Gyeonggi-do, Korea. 2.2 Laboratory Accreditations and Listings Country Agency Registration Number USA CANADA KOREA FCC ISED NRRA 805871 8737A-2 KR0025 2.3 Calibration Details of Equipment Used for Measurement Test equipment and test accessories are calibrated on regular basis. The maximum time between calibrations is one year or what is recommended by the manufacturer, whichever is less. All test equipment calibrations are traceable to the Korea Research Institute of Standards and Science (KRISS), therefore, all test data recorded in this report is traceable to KRISS. CTK-2019-02013 Page (119) / (158) Pages 4.5 Frequency Stability Test Procedures The EUT was placed inside of an environmental chamber as the temperature in the chamber was varied between 0 and +40 (Declaration by the Manufacturer). The temperature was incremented by 10 (5 ) intervals and the unit was allowed to stabilize at each temperature before each measurement. The center frequency of the transmitting channel was evaluated at each temperature and the frequency deviation from the channels center frequency was recorded. 3 m SAC (test distance : 3 m) 10 m, 3 m) Test Procedures 1) In the frequency range of 9 kHz to 30 MHz, magnetic field is measured with Loop Antenna. The Test Antenna is positioned with its plane vertical at 1m distance from the EUT. The center of the Loop Test Antenna is 1m above the ground. During the measurement the Loop Test Antenna rotates about its vertical axis for maximum response at each azimuth about the EUT. 2) In the frequency rage above 30 MHz, Bi-Log Test Antenna(30 MHz to 1 GHz) and Horn Test Antenna(above 1 GHz) are used. Test Antenna is 3m away from the EUT. Test Antenna height is carried from 1m to 4m above the ground to determine the maximum value of the field strength. The emissions levels at both horizontal and vertical polarizations should be tested. Test Settings:
